Tibialis Anterior

A muscle in the lower leg that is involved in dorsiflexion and inversion of the foot.

Biceps Femoris

A muscle of the posterior thigh involved in knee flexion and hip extension, part of the hamstrings group.

Extensor Digitorum Longus

The extensor digitorum longus is a muscle in the lower leg that helps extend the toes and dorsiflex the foot, facilitating walking and running.

Sartorius

The longest muscle in the human body, extending from the hip to the knee, involved in flexing, abducting, and rotating the thigh.
